What we’ll look at

When can a photograph be trusted as evidence?

White letters float on a field of blue. They name a new kind of book: Photographs of British Algae: Cyanotype Impressions. Anna Atkins made the title page photographically, but its calligraphy, ruled border, binding, page order, chemistry, and careful presentation make it impossible to call the result an untouched piece of nature.

That is the productive difficulty at the centre of photography. Light acts on a prepared surface. Something stood before a lens or rested on sensitised paper. Yet the resulting trace never arrives alone. A maker selects the apparatus, process, moment, duration, viewpoint, and object. Someone develops, fixes, prints, titles, sequences, publishes, files, copies, or discards it. Later institutions add dates, categories, captions, rights statements, and search terms.

Photography is a material trace, not automatic truth

A photograph begins with a causal event: light reflected or emitted from the world changes a photosensitive material or, in digital systems, produces measured signals. That physical relation distinguishes a photograph from an image invented wholly by hand. It does not certify every claim attached to the result.

The camera records only what its apparatus can register during an exposure. Colour sensitivity, lens, focus, plate or paper, chemical preparation, weather, movement, and processing determine what becomes visible. Framing excludes what lies beside and behind the camera. A title may identify a place accurately, approximately, strategically, or incorrectly. A sequence may establish chronology or simulate it.

Scope: five objects and a deliberately limited archive

The chapter follows five works made between about 1838 and 1873: Louis Daguerre’s view of the Boulevard du Temple in Paris; Atkins’s cyanotype book of British algae; Roger Fenton’s Crimean War landscape; Timothy O’Sullivan’s photograph of Canyon de Chelly, or Tséyi’; and Felice Beato’s view inside the North Dagu, historically Taku, Fort after its capture.

This is not a complete origin story. It cannot stand for early photographic practice in Africa, South Asia, Latin America, the Ottoman world, China, Japan, or the many local studios and image traditions that reworked imported processes. It omits portraiture, policing, medicine, astronomy, spirit photography, family albums, stereographs, abolitionist practice, and photography by colonised people.

Process determines what kind of object can circulate

Daguerreotypes are direct positive images on silver-coated copper plates. Each plate is a singular object whose appearance changes with viewing angle and light. A cyanotype uses iron salts and water to form a blue image; Atkins placed specimens against sensitised paper, making a one-to-one silhouette while repeating the process across pages.

Fenton used wet-collodion glass negatives and made salted-paper prints. Beato also worked with cumbersome glass negatives, from which albumen silver prints could be produced and assembled into albums. O’Sullivan’s survey photographs likewise circulated as albumen prints in government volumes. A negative allowed multiple positives, but every print still involved paper, chemistry, exposure, washing, mounting, and decisions about tone.

Daguerre’s boulevard records duration, not an instant

In brief: Louis Daguerre photographed this Paris boulevard around 1838 using a process that required a long exposure. Most of the crowd disappeared, while two people who stayed still long enough remained visible.

A high view across Paris rooftops and the Boulevard du Temple appears almost empty, except for two small dark figures near the lower-left street corner.
Louis-Jacques-Mandé Daguerre, Boulevard du Temple, about 1838, daguerreotype; Bayerisches Nationalmuseum, Munich. Object group record · image file, Public Domain Mark. The local derivative preserves the full surviving image and was resized to WebP without cropping.

Daguerre looked from an elevated position across roofs toward a broad Parisian street. Buildings, trees, chimneys, pavement, and sky accumulate extraordinary detail. The road appears strangely quiet. Near the lower left, a small upright person seems to face another figure at foot level, conventionally interpreted as a customer remaining still while a shoeshiner worked.

The Bayerisches Nationalmuseum preserves Daguerre’s gift to King Ludwig I of Bavaria as a triptych of Paris street views and a study of antique sculptures, with originals, later facsimiles, original mount, dedication, and frame. The street plates are labelled midday and eight in the morning. The familiar image is therefore one member of a comparative presentation, not an isolated miracle.

Moving crowds can vanish while stillness appears

The boulevard was not necessarily empty. A long exposure could fail to register pedestrians and vehicles that moved through each position too quickly to create a stable deposit. Architecture remained. A person who paused could appear. Time did not stop; the plate accumulated some effects of time while losing others.

This makes absence an ambiguous visual fact. The image can show that the road surface did not retain most moving bodies under that exposure. It cannot by itself prove that no crowd passed. Nor can the tiny surviving figures tell us their names, relationship, occupation with certainty, or awareness of the camera.

A unique plate resists the logic of limitless copies

The daguerreotype is often described as a mirror with a memory because its polished metal surface can shift between positive and negative as it catches light. That experience is difficult to reproduce on a luminous screen. A modern digital file gives broad access to the composition while flattening reflectivity, scale, enclosure, scratches, and the viewer’s movement before the object.

Uniqueness shaped use. A plate could not simply generate a print run as a negative could. It could be copied through engraving, lithography, or another photograph, but each translation changed tone, orientation, detail, and material status. The image’s fame therefore depends on reproductions that contradict its original singularity.

Gift, frame, facsimile, and museum make public evidence

Daguerre’s triptych arrived as a diplomatic and technological demonstration addressed to a king. Dedication and frame made the new process a gift, a claim to prestige, and a carefully staged encounter. Royal ownership helped validate photography before a broad public could practise or even see it.

Evidence includes that biography. The street scene is evidence of an exposure, but the triptych is also evidence of photography’s institutional introduction. To cite only the visible boulevard loses how gift, enclosure, copy, royal recipient, and museum custody made the plate durable and authoritative.

Atkins made a scientific book in blue

Atkins began issuing Photographs of British Algae: Cyanotype Impressions in fascicles in 1843 and continued the project for a decade. The Metropolitan Museum of Art’s album contains 154 cyanotypes. Its record describes it as the first book photographically printed and illustrated—a precise institutional claim about book form, not proof that Atkins alone invented photography.

The cyanotype process had been announced by astronomer and chemist John Herschel in 1842. Atkins adapted it to botanical study. She placed wet algae directly on light-sensitised paper, exposed the sheet to sunlight, and washed it. Exposed areas became Prussian blue while the specimen blocked light and left a pale silhouette.

The title page uses the same process for language. Handwritten and cut or arranged lettering became a photographic impression. Scientific image, calligraphy, border, ornament, and book design occupy one blue field. The album announces from its opening that photography can classify and compose simultaneously.

Contact does not remove arrangement

Because the algae touched the paper, each silhouette has a strong causal intimacy with a specimen. Fine branching structures can appear without the interpretive hand of an engraver. This made cyanotype useful where outline, proportion, and repeated division carried botanical information.

Contact is not neutrality. Atkins selected specimens she collected or received, separated and spread their fronds, chose orientation, decided whether parts overlapped, exposed under variable sunlight, washed the sheet, judged the result, and sometimes tried again. Pressure and moisture affected contact. The living organism became a gathered, flattened, named sample.

A book turned repeated exposure into scientific sequence

One cyanotype does not make a taxonomy. Atkins joined impressions to handwritten labels and arranged them according to the nomenclature of William Henry Harvey’s Manual of the British Algae of 1841. The book made specimens comparable across pages while supplying names that the images could not generate themselves.

Fascicle publication distributed work over time. Surviving copies differ in contents and order because Atkins revised and assembled them by hand. “The book” is therefore both a recognised project and a group of materially non-identical objects. Repetition created scientific reach without industrial uniformity.

Scientific naming and aesthetic composition coexist

The Met stresses that artistic expression was not Atkins’s primary goal while recognising the elegance of her arrangements. That distinction is useful only if it does not divide the pages into scientific information on one side and decorative beauty on the other.

Clarity itself can be designed. Spacing prevents branches from collapsing into a knot; contrast makes morphology readable; orientation gives the eye a route; handwritten labels link name and form. The same decisions that make a page compelling can make it useful for comparison. Beauty is not proof of inaccuracy.

Fenton arrived after action with a difficult camera

A barren dirt road curves through low rocky slopes while round cannon shot lies across the road and surrounding ground.
Roger Fenton, The Valley of the Shadow of Death, 23 April 1855, salted-paper print from a glass negative; Library of Congress, LC-DIG-ppmsca-35546. Object and rights record, no known restrictions on publication. Resized to WebP without cropping.

In 1855 Fenton travelled to Crimea with a horse-drawn darkroom, large camera, fragile glass plates, chemicals, water, and assistants. The wet-collodion process required coating, sensitising, exposing, and developing a plate while it remained wet. Equipment and chemistry constrained where and when he could work.

Long exposure and operational danger made combat action effectively inaccessible. Fenton photographed camps, officers, soldiers, roads, harbours, batteries, and ground marked by violence. The Valley of the Shadow of Death shows no charge and no wounded body. A road bends between bare slopes under a blank sky; spent round shot supplies the event’s residue.

Two negatives make evidence comparative

Fenton made two negatives from almost the same camera position. In one, cannon shot lies mainly beside the road. In the other—the version reproduced here—many balls occupy the roadway. Comparison establishes that objects moved between exposures. It does not, by itself, identify who moved them, whether movement was purposeful staging, salvage, clearing, danger, or some combination.

That limit matters. A single image may feel self-evident; the pair reveals an intervention. Yet even the pair needs physical and historical research: negative sequence, changing shadows, plate marks, Fenton’s letters, military practice, and later print histories. Digital comparison can strengthen an inference without reading intention directly from pixels.

Cannonballs signify casualties without showing bodies

The round shot gives scale, repetition, and threat to otherwise empty terrain. Near balls appear large enough to count; distant ones recede into a trail. Their distribution turns the road into a field of impacts. The biblical title, derived from Psalm 23 and used by troops for a dangerous place, intensifies the landscape’s metaphorical force.

The photograph is not an inventory of the Crimean War’s causes, combatants, deaths, disease, supply failures, or civilian experience. It makes one aftermath eloquent. Cannon shot can stand for casualties while protecting viewers from the bodies whose absence allows symbolic contemplation.

War photography is also logistics and circulation

Fenton produced several hundred Crimean negatives in a few months, but photographs did not move through illustrated newspapers as direct halftone reproductions in 1855. Prints were exhibited and sold; engravings could translate photographic information into mass print. The public encountered a mediated campaign through selection, caption, publisher, exhibition, and price.

The wet plate’s slowness also organised the represented military world. Officers able to pose and camps stable enough for equipment entered the archive more readily than assault, panic, or rapidly changing civilian harm. Technical limitation and social access reinforced one another.

O’Sullivan made a Diné homeland into survey space

A mounted albumen photograph shows immense sandstone walls and narrow rock towers above a canyon floor with two very small human figures.
Timothy H. O'Sullivan, Cañon de Chelle. Walls of the Grand Cañon about 1200 Feet in Height, 1873, albumen print, plate 12 in the Wheeler Survey volume; Library of Congress, LC-DIG-ppmsca-10057. Object and rights record, no known restrictions on publication. Resized to WebP without cropping.

O’Sullivan made this photograph during a United States War Department survey led by Lieutenant George M. Wheeler. The image later appeared in a government volume of landscapes, geology, settlements, Indigenous people, camps, and routes made during expeditions west of the hundredth meridian.

The caption calls the place “Cañon de Chelle,” a Spanish rendering connected to the Diné name Tséyi’, “within the rocks.” Today Canyon de Chelly National Monument states plainly that Diné families live, farm, and raise livestock there; the land lies within the Navajo Nation and is managed through partnership with it. The canyon is not an empty geological specimen.

Tiny figures establish scale and a viewing position

Sandstone walls enclose the view while three narrow rock towers rise near the right. Two tiny figures stand on the canyon floor. They may be survey participants, local guides, or other people; this photograph alone does not identify them. Their scale makes the cliffs appear immense and gives viewers a human unit of measure.

The figures also disclose staging. Someone chose where the camera stood, where the people paused, and when the plate was exposed. O’Sullivan had to translate an enormous space onto a glass negative and later a mounted print. Monumentality is produced through viewpoint, tonal contrast, lens, foreground, figure placement, and the caption’s estimate of 1,200 feet.

Caption and survey rename inhabited land

The printed mount carries the War Department and Corps of Engineers identity above the photograph. O’Sullivan’s name is small; the survey command, official crest, numbered plate, place name, and height claim organise the image as federal knowledge. The mount is part of the photograph’s argument, not empty border.

Government surveys gathered topographic, geological, military, ethnographic, and resource information useful for settlement and control. Their categories could separate “landscape” from the people whose laws, histories, names, farming, and sacred relations made it homeland. A view that seems to discover untouched nature follows recent conquest.

The archive must reconnect image to forced removal

The United States Army conducted a destructive campaign against the Navajo in 1863–1864, burning crops, killing livestock, and forcing thousands on the Long Walk to incarceration at Bosque Redondo. Many died. The 1868 treaty permitted survivors to return to a reduced part of their homeland. O’Sullivan arrived only five years later with a military survey.

That chronology changes the photograph. An apparently timeless canyon follows forced removal and return. The tiny human presence cannot be read as generic scale alone when the institution behind the plate had recently participated in dispossession across the region.

Beato photographed a fort after imperial violence

Content note: the photograph and discussion below include visible bodies of Chinese soldiers after battle.

Inside a damaged earthen fort, ladders, baskets, broken structures, weapons, and the bodies of Chinese soldiers lie across the foreground and ramparts.
Felice Beato, Interior of the Angle of North Fort, 21–22 August 1860, albumen silver print; J. Paul Getty Museum, 84.XA.886.5.15. Object record · image file, Public Domain Mark. Resized to WebP without cropping.

Beato entered the North Dagu Fort soon after Anglo-French forces captured it during the Second Opium War. The photograph looks across ruptured earthworks, ladders, baskets, platforms, guns, debris, and Chinese dead. No living victor stands at the centre, but conquest structures every visible condition.

The Getty record identifies the print as one of eight views that recreate the event in sequence. British military physician David F. Rennie remembered Beato asking that a group of bodies not be disturbed until he photographed it. The statement documents urgency and an aestheticising response by a witness; it does not tell us what the dead would have consented to or how their families understood the image.

The war forced Qing China into further unequal concessions after a conflict bound to foreign demands, diplomacy, trade, and the illegal British opium economy. “After capture” is therefore not a neutral time label. It announces the viewpoint of the force that gained the fort.

The camera’s delay determines whose bodies appear

Early wet-plate photography could not record the assault at battle speed. It could record bodies that no longer moved. The same technical threshold that erased traffic from Daguerre’s boulevard gave the dead a terrible photographic visibility. Stillness is not a formal property without politics.

Beato had to prepare and process large glass plates near the battlefield. That labour has often been used to celebrate his endurance. It should also direct attention to unequal vulnerability. The photographer could withdraw with his apparatus; the soldiers in the image could not control pose, caption, sale, or later display.

An ethical account neither hides the photograph nor treats shock as knowledge. It describes only what is necessary, gives the conflict and named location, acknowledges the bodies as people rather than compositional elements, and warns viewers. The image can document imperial violence while repeating an imperial relation of looking.

Sequence, caption, and album organise colonial victory

The Dagu photographs move from approach and breached defences to interiors, bodies, and occupied space. When arranged as a sequence, they can simulate the progress of battle even though exposure order followed practical need: bodies had to be photographed before removal, while exterior and architectural views could wait.

Captions direct that reconstruction. Terms such as “English entrance,” “French entrance,” and “immediately after its capture” map allied action onto the fort. Beato sold photographs to soldiers and assembled views into albums. A military record became a souvenir, commercial product, family possession, and evidence of imperial reach.

Albums are arguments made through order. They can move viewers from obstacle to breach to aftermath and make victory seem coherent. The Historical Photographs of China project, mirrored by Shanghai Jiao Tong University, allows dispersed prints and captions to be studied together. Reconstructing the series exposes how a single iconic image belonged to a larger campaign narrative.

Showing the dead does not explain the war

Graphic visibility can defeat the comforting claim that war left only damaged architecture. It can also narrow explanation to the instant after violence. The photograph does not show the opium trade, treaty negotiations, decisions in London, Paris, and Beijing, naval bombardment, civilian deaths, looting, the destruction of the imperial gardens, or Chinese accounts of defeat.

Nor is the camera simply on “the side of victims” because bodies appear. Beato travelled with invading forces, relied on military access, photographed from captured ground, and sold to a Western audience. The evidential trace and its imperial conditions must be held together.

The strongest historical use is relational. Place the image beside Qing and foreign documents, Chinese scholarship, campaign memoirs read critically, maps, material remains, other photographs in the series, and the later lives of the prints. A photograph can make denial harder without making interpretation unnecessary.

Photography became art through decisions, not escape from fact

Early debates often placed mechanical record against artistic invention. The five objects dissolve that opposition. Daguerre chose an elevated urban view and comparative time labels. Atkins arranged specimen, page, script, and sequence. Fenton compressed war into a curving road and scattered shot. O’Sullivan converted scale into stark geometry. Beato constructed an album narrative from delayed aftermaths.

None of these choices eliminates the world’s action on sensitive material. Artistry lies partly in deciding what relation to establish with that action. Composition can clarify evidence, turn it into metaphor, beautify domination, preserve ambiguity, or do several at once.

Institutional recognition then changes status. Scientific album, royal gift, publisher’s exhibition, federal survey volume, commercial war album, and art museum do not merely contain photographs. They propose ways of seeing them. “Art” is not a substance discovered inside the image; it is a contested practice and history of attention.

Reproduction expands access and changes authority

Paper negatives and glass negatives made multiple positives possible, while printed albums organised those copies for distant readers. Engravings translated photographs into mass-circulation newspapers before direct photomechanical reproduction became common. Every route widened access while altering scale, tone, detail, caption, and sequence.

Digital files continue that history. They let a student compare Fenton’s variants, inspect Atkins’s title page, or read the official mount around O’Sullivan’s print without travelling. They also make photographs look frictionlessly interchangeable. A daguerreotype, cyanotype, salted-paper print, albumen print, scan, and compressed WebP can occupy the same rectangle on screen.

Good digital use records the translation. Link the object record and image file; state rights; preserve the full composition; record intrinsic dimensions; identify resizing or cropping; distinguish an original print from a modern scan. Access becomes more trustworthy when its transformations are visible.

Evidence requires a chain, not a feeling of reality

A convincing photographic claim should connect at least six links: the event or object before the camera; the apparatus and process; the resulting negative, plate, or print; its caption and sequence; its custody and reproduction history; and the question a researcher asks. A broken link does not always destroy evidence, but it limits what can be claimed.

For Daguerre, the plate can establish duration-sensitive urban detail, not an empty street. For Atkins, contact can establish outline and arrangement, not a whole ecology. Fenton’s paired negatives establish movement of cannon shot, not motive by themselves. O’Sullivan’s mounted print establishes a survey view, not vacant land. Beato’s exposure establishes visible aftermath, not a complete cause of war.

This method avoids two lazy extremes. “The camera never lies” ignores mediation. “All photographs are constructed, so nothing is knowable” ignores material constraint and comparative research. Evidence is graded, situated, and revisable.

A comparison matrix

Object Process and form Evidential strength Institutional operation Critical limit
Daguerre, Boulevard du Temple Unique daguerreotype plate within a framed triptych Fine architectural detail and duration-sensitive visibility Gift to Ludwig I; later facsimile, conservation, museum catalogue, and digital copy Movement can disappear; the plate does not prove an empty street or identify the tiny figures
Atkins, British Algae Cameraless cyanotypes assembled and labelled as a book Direct specimen contact preserves outline and branching for comparison Botanical network, fascicle publication, hand assembly, later museum access Flattened silhouette omits colour, habitat, volume, and ecological relation; identification can change
Fenton, Valley of the Shadow of Death Glass negative and salted-paper prints; two variants Terrain, shot, and comparison between exposures Commission, royal access, commercial exhibition and sale, later archives Changed cannonball positions do not alone disclose mover or motive; battle and casualties remain outside frame
O’Sullivan, Cañon de Chelle Glass negative and albumen print on a numbered federal mount Landform, survey presence, caption, and scale construction War Department survey, government volume, federal and museum archives Military naming and measurement can suppress Diné sovereignty, recent forced removal, and living presence
Beato, Interior of North Fort Glass negative, albumen print, campaign sequence, and album Immediate visible aftermath and material state of captured fort Military access, captions, commercial albums, imperial circulation Bodies are exposed without consent; victors’ sequence does not explain war or preserve Chinese testimony

What the surviving archive overrepresents

The archive is dense where states, armies, publishers, collectors, and museums invested in objects. Daguerre’s royal gift, Fenton’s commission, O’Sullivan’s federal survey, and Beato’s military access generated records because powerful institutions wanted images. Atkins’s hand-built books survived through learned networks and collectors, but many contributors and specimens remain less visible than the named author.

Survival also favours stillness and property. Buildings, geology, pressed specimens, officers, weapons, and bodies could endure an exposure. Moving labour, conversation, fear, refusal, and people who controlled neither camera nor caption disappeared more easily.

Digital abundance can conceal this imbalance. Thousands of scans do not equal representative history if they reproduce one institution’s categories. Search results inherit titles and descriptions written by surveyors, conquerors, collectors, and older catalogues. Research must use the archive and study how it was built.

Common survey traps

“The first photograph tells us when photography began.” Multiple inventors, experiments, private demonstrations, public announcements, processes, and survival histories make singular firsts unstable. State the exact claim and source.

“Daguerre photographed an empty Paris.” Long exposure could erase moving traffic. The plate records duration-sensitive visibility, not a census.

“Atkins removed the artist’s hand.” Contact reduced one kind of translation while selection, arrangement, chemistry, naming, and book design remained.

“Fenton moved the cannonballs.” The two negatives show that positions changed; identify agency and motive only to the degree external evidence supports them.

“A government survey is neutral science.” Measurement can be accurate while serving military intelligence, settlement, resource extraction, and territorial rule.

“Canyon de Chelly was an empty sublime landscape.” It is Tséyi’, a living Diné homeland photographed shortly after forced removal and return.

“Graphic suffering explains violence.” Visibility can document harm, but cause, responsibility, and testimony require other evidence.

“A negative means unlimited identical copies.” Prints vary, materials decay, editions end, and captions or albums alter meaning.

“Calling photography art makes truth irrelevant.” Artistic and evidential claims can coexist and must each be tested.

Questions for close looking

  1. What photographic process produced the object, and is this a plate, negative, print, page, album, reproduction, or digital surrogate?
  2. What duration did the exposure record, and what kinds of movement became invisible?
  3. Who selected the viewpoint, arranged the subject, prepared materials, processed the image, and supplied its title?
  4. Does another negative, print, page, caption, or frame allow comparison?
  5. Which claim is supported by visible detail, and which depends on external documentation?
  6. Who commissioned, financed, transported, purchased, published, filed, or collected the photograph?
  7. What sequence does an album, survey, exhibition, or website create?
  8. Whose names and testimony survive, and who appears only as type, scale figure, specimen, or body?
  9. How do scientific usefulness and aesthetic organisation support or complicate one another?
  10. What changed when the object became a scan, and are rights and transformations documented?

Terms for photography, evidence, and circulation

Daguerreotype: a direct positive image on a sensitised, silver-coated copper plate; extremely detailed, reflective, fragile, and normally unique.

Cyanotype: an iron-based photographic process that produces a blue image; in a contact photogram, covered areas remain pale while exposed paper turns blue.

Photogram: an image made by placing objects on or near light-sensitive material without a camera lens.

Wet-collodion negative: a glass plate coated, sensitised, exposed, and developed while wet; capable of fine detail but demanding portable darkroom labour.

Salted-paper print: a paper positive, often made from a paper or glass negative, whose image is embedded in the paper fibres and tends toward a matte surface.

Albumen silver print: a photographic print on paper coated with egg white and salts, producing a relatively glossy, detailed surface; dominant in the later nineteenth century.

Indexical trace: a sign caused by physical contact or connection with what it records. The connection constrains an image but does not validate every interpretation.

Chain of custody: documented movement, ownership, handling, and preservation of evidence from creation to current use.

Survey: a coordinated programme of measurement, description, mapping, image making, and classification; both a knowledge practice and a potential instrument of rule.

Caption: text that identifies and frames an image. It can preserve indispensable context, repeat historical power, or introduce error.

A working timeline, c. 1838–1875

  • About 1838: Daguerre makes the surviving Boulevard du Temple plates later presented to Ludwig I of Bavaria.
  • 7 January 1839: François Arago announces Daguerre’s process to the French Académie des Sciences; full public instructions follow in August.
  • 1841: William Henry Fox Talbot patents the calotype negative-positive process in Britain; William Henry Harvey publishes his Manual of the British Algae.
  • 1842: John Herschel announces the cyanotype process.
  • 1843: Atkins begins issuing Photographs of British Algae in fascicles.
  • 1844–1846: Talbot publishes The Pencil of Nature, joining photographs and text in a commercially issued book.
  • 1851: Frederick Scott Archer publishes the wet-collodion process, increasing detail and reducing exposure while requiring immediate plate preparation and development.
  • 23 April 1855: Fenton makes two exposures in the Crimean location called the Valley of the Shadow of Death.
  • 1855–1856: Fenton’s Crimean photographs are exhibited and offered for sale through Thomas Agnew and other dealers.
  • 21 August 1860: Anglo-French forces capture the North Dagu Fort; Beato photographs its aftermath and the wider campaign.
  • 1863–1864: the U.S. military campaign against the Navajo destroys resources and forces thousands onto the Long Walk to Bosque Redondo.
  • 1868: a treaty permits the Navajo to return to a portion of their homeland.
  • 1873: O’Sullivan photographs Canyon de Chelly during the Wheeler Survey.
  • 1875: the War Department publishes a volume of fifty mounted survey photographs from the 1871–1873 expeditions.

Source guide

The material starting points are the Bayerisches Nationalmuseum’s record for Daguerre’s framed triptych given to Ludwig I and Malcolm Daniel’s Met essay on Daguerre’s process, Niépce partnership, institutional announcement, and art-science claims. The museum’s image carries a restrictive CC BY-NC-ND notice, so the local article file instead derives from a separately verified Public Domain Mark reproduction on Wikimedia Commons.

The Met’s Open Access record for Atkins’s Photographs of British Algae establishes date, process, extent, dimensions, method, Harvey nomenclature, and public-domain status. Its public collection API supplied the full-resolution hero file. The record’s “first book photographically printed and illustrated” language is retained as an attributed institutional claim rather than widened into a universal invention myth.

For Fenton, use the Library of Congress object and rights record, the Getty’s survey of his Crimean work, and the Getty’s open research volume Roger Fenton: Photographer of the 1850s. The existence of two negatives establishes rearrangement between exposures; interpretations of sequence and staging should identify the comparison and remain clear about what motive cannot be recovered from image data alone.

For O’Sullivan, the Library of Congress records the individual plate and the fifty-print Wheeler Survey volume. Robin E. Kelsey’s named study, “Viewing the Archive: Timothy O’Sullivan’s Photographs for the Wheeler Survey, 1871–74”, analyses how survey graphics, scientific limitation, and political persuasion interact. The Canyon de Chelly National Monument, managed with the Navajo Nation on tribal trust land, identifies Tséyi’ as a living Diné homeland; NPS history documents the Long Walk and return.

For Beato, begin with the Getty object record, its exhibition Felice Beato: A Photographer on the Eastern Road, and the Getty’s open scholarly catalogue. The University of Bristol’s Historical Photographs of China, mirrored by Shanghai Jiao Tong University, reconstructs dispersed Dagu prints and rests on Terry Bennett’s named scholarship. MIT Visualizing Cultures provides a contextual, source-rich chapter on Beato’s battlefield views, captions, albums, Chinese absence, and imperial circulation.
